Versatility - Definition, Meaning Synonyms | Vocabulary. com The noun versatility derives from the Latin word versatilis, meaning "turning, revolving, moving, capable of turning to varied subjects or tasks " Companies seek employees who have versatility so they can adapt to different work situations
